Ingredients
Two desserts in one – fudgy brownies topped with rich pecan pie filling. A decadent treat that combines everyone’s favorites.
For the Brownies
- 1 box brownie mix
- 3 tablespoons water
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 2 eggs
For the Pecan Pie Topping
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 1/2 cups light corn syrup
- 4 eggs
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 3 cups whole pecans
How to Make Pecan Pie Brownies
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ures your brownies bake evenly and achieve that perfect texture.
Step 2: Prepare the Brownie Batter
- In a mixing bowl, combine the boxed brownie mix with 3 tablespoons water, 1/2 cup vegetable oil, and 2 eggs.
- Mix until just combined; avoid overmixing to keep your brownies fudgy.
Step 3: Bake the Brownies
- Pour the batter into a greased 9×13 inch pan.
- Bake in the preheated oven for about 25 minutes.
- Allow them to cool for approximately 10 minutes before adding the topping.
Step 4: Make the Pecan Pie Filling
- In a saucepan over medium heat, whisk together 1 cup granulated sugar, 1 1/2 cups light corn syrup, 4 eggs, 1/4 cup unsalted butter, and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ract.
- Cook this mixture for about 10-15 minutes until it thickens slightly.
Step 5: Combine Pecans and Fillings
Remove from heat and stir in 3 cups whole pecans. This adds both crunch and flavor to your topping.
Step 6: Add the Topping
Pour the pecan mixture over your cooled brownies evenly, spreading it out if necessary.
Step 7: Final Bake
Return the pan to the oven and bake for another 25 minutes until the topping bubbles slightly.
Step 8: Cool and Serve
Let your Pecan Pie Brownies cool completely before cutting into squares. Enjoy this delicious dessert warm or at room temperature!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Item: Store in an airtight container.
- Item: Keep in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.
- Item: Layer parchment paper between brownies if stacking.
Freezing Pecan Pie Brownies
- Item: Wrap brownies tightly in plastic wrap or foil.
- Item: Store in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months.
- Item: Thaw in the refrigerator overnight before serving.
Reheating Pecan Pie Brownies
- Oven: Preheat oven to 350°F, place brownies on a baking sheet, and heat for about 10-15 minutes.
- Microwave: Heat individual servings on high for about 20-30 seconds until warm.
- Stovetop: Use a skillet on low heat; cover with a lid and heat slowly for about 5-7 minutes.
Frequently Asked Questions
What are Pecan Pie Brownies?
Pecan Pie Brownies are a delightful dessert that combines rich, fudgy brownie layers with sweet pecan pie filling, creating a perfect blend of flavors.
Can I use a homemade brownie recipe?
Yes! While using a box mix is convenient, you can easily substitute it with your favorite homemade brownie recipe for a personalized touch.
How do I prevent my brownies from being too gooey?
To avoid overly gooey brownies, ensure you bake them long enough and check for doneness with a toothpick. It should come out with moist crumbs but not wet batter.
Can I add chocolate chips?
Absolutely! Adding chocolate chips enhances the flavor of Pecan Pie Brownies. Just fold them into the brownie batter before baking.
